Current Investigations and Official Responses
When a railway accident occurs, the response is massive. Usually, there's an immediate response team, which includes emergency services, medical personnel, and railway staff. Their primary goal is to help the injured and secure the area. An investigation is launched immediately to find out what went wrong. These investigations are typically led by a government agency, like the National Transportation Safety Board (NTSB) in the United States, or similar bodies in other countries. The investigation teams are highly skilled and use a wide range of tools and techniques to find out exactly what happened. They collect data from the train's black box (the event recorder), analyze the track conditions, inspect the rolling stock (the train cars), and interview everyone involved. These investigations are very detailed and can take months, sometimes even years, to complete. During this time, they gather all kinds of evidence, from photos and videos to witness statements and technical reports. The goal is to figure out the exact sequence of events that led to the accident. Based on their findings, the investigating body issues a final report that includes the probable cause of the accident. These reports are really important because they often make recommendations for preventing future accidents. This might include suggestions for new safety regulations, changes in operational procedures, or improvements to infrastructure. Railway companies and government agencies then take these recommendations seriously, and implement changes based on the findings. Depending on the severity of the accident, there might also be legal or civil action taken against the people or companies deemed responsible. It’s all about accountability, and ensuring that similar accidents are avoided in the future. So, the process is detailed and thorough, and it plays a critical role in improving railway safety.

Infrastructure Failures and Maintenance Issues
One of the biggest culprits is infrastructure failure. Things like worn-out tracks, corroded bridges, or poorly maintained signaling systems can all lead to disaster. Just imagine a crack in a rail that wasn't spotted during routine inspections, or a signal that fails at a critical moment. That’s why maintenance is crucial. Regular inspections, timely repairs, and upgrades are absolutely necessary. If you skimp on maintenance, you're playing a dangerous game. It is a proactive approach to safety. By doing regular checks and fixing things as needed, they can catch problems before they become major issues. The right maintenance also means using the right materials and techniques, so that the infrastructure can withstand the demands placed on it. Infrastructure failures often stem from a lack of investment. Railway infrastructure is super expensive to maintain and improve, and sometimes funding gets cut, which is a big problem. Also, outdated infrastructure can lead to all sorts of issues. Some railway systems are decades old, and were never designed for the speeds and volumes of traffic they carry today. Upgrading them can be a massive undertaking, but it is necessary for safety. If we don't fix the infrastructure, the consequences can be tragic. So, keeping everything in good shape is essential for the smooth and safe operation of trains.

External Factors and Environmental Conditions
External factors, like weather, can also play a major role in railway accidents. Severe weather conditions, such as heavy rain, snow, fog, and even extreme heat, can create challenging and dangerous conditions for trains. Heavy rain and flooding can lead to track washouts, landslides, and the disruption of signaling systems. Snow and ice can make it difficult for trains to brake and navigate the tracks, which also increases the risk of derailments. Fog can limit visibility, making it hard for train operators to see signals and other trains. Extreme heat can cause the rails to expand and buckle, which can also lead to derailments. Environmental factors also include natural disasters. Earthquakes, hurricanes, and other extreme events can damage infrastructure and cause accidents. So, it's important to develop and implement proactive measures to mitigate the risks. This might include weather forecasting to monitor conditions, speed restrictions when there is heavy rain or snow, and also the use of specialized equipment to remove snow and ice. Environmental awareness is very important. Railway operators need to be aware of the environmental conditions and adjust their operations accordingly. This can involve slowing down trains, rerouting them, or even shutting down the service. So, the railways need to be prepared and implement proactive measures to keep passengers safe, despite the weather and other external elements.
How Railway Accidents Are Investigated
So, after a railway accident occurs, the investigation process begins. It is a very complex and comprehensive process designed to determine the cause of the accident, identify any contributing factors, and make recommendations to prevent future incidents. The investigation team usually consists of a lot of experts, like railway engineers, accident reconstruction specialists, and experts in human factors, and the team will collect all kinds of data. This includes information from the train's event recorders (also known as black boxes), which record the speed, braking, and other operational data, and also from the trackside signals and other equipment. They will also inspect the site of the accident, document the damage, and collect physical evidence. It's crucial for understanding exactly what happened. Witnesses are usually interviewed to gather their accounts of the events, and understand the events that led to the accident. The investigation will also analyze all the factors that may have contributed to the accident. This might include infrastructure failures, human error, and environmental factors. After the investigation is complete, the team will make a report that includes the findings, the cause of the accident, and recommendations for preventing similar accidents. These recommendations are important. They can be about changes to operating procedures, infrastructure improvements, and enhanced safety regulations. The investigation process is all about making sure that the rail industry learns from its mistakes and constantly strives to improve safety.
The Role of Safety Regulations and Standards
Safety regulations and standards are crucial for preventing railway accidents. These regulations set the minimum requirements for railway operations, and they cover everything from track maintenance to employee training to the design of rolling stock. They're designed to reduce the risk of accidents. Safety regulations are set and enforced by government agencies, like the Federal Railroad Administration (FRA) in the United States, and similar organizations around the world. These agencies work to create and maintain safety standards, conduct inspections, and investigate accidents. Without these regulations, the railway would be a lot more dangerous. Safety regulations cover many areas of railway operations. These include track maintenance and inspection, signal systems, train control, operating procedures, and employee training. There are also requirements for the design and construction of railway cars and locomotives, and rules for the transportation of hazardous materials. Compliance with safety regulations is mandatory for all railway companies. They have to adhere to the standards to operate. Non-compliance can lead to penalties, including fines, and even suspension of operations. Railway companies also have internal safety programs, and they have to implement their own safety measures and policies to ensure they are meeting all the requirements. So, safety regulations are really important. They are the backbone of railway safety, and are always evolving as new technologies and better safety practices are developed.
Technological Advancements in Railway Safety
Okay, let's look at the cool tech that's helping improve railway safety. There are a lot of advancements. Advanced technologies are being used to make railways safer. One of the key advancements is Positive Train Control (PTC) which is a system that automatically controls train movement to prevent collisions, speed-related accidents, and derailments. PTC uses GPS, radio communication, and onboard computers to monitor train positions and speed, and if a train is at risk of exceeding the speed limit or entering a restricted area, the system automatically slows or stops the train. Then there are also improved signaling systems. These systems use electronic signals and advanced sensors to control train movement and ensure that trains are spaced safely apart. Then there is automated track inspection. Automated systems use lasers, cameras, and other sensors to inspect the tracks for defects and identify potential problems before they lead to an accident. Next, there are also advanced braking systems. These systems provide enhanced braking performance and are designed to reduce stopping distances. Also, there are driver-assistance systems. These systems use sensors and cameras to help train operators detect potential hazards and improve their situational awareness. These are designed to detect obstacles on the tracks, monitor the train's speed, and provide warnings to the operator. The use of data analytics is also important. Big data is used to analyze accident data, identify trends, and develop targeted safety interventions. Predictive maintenance is also used. Predictive maintenance systems use sensors and data analytics to monitor the condition of equipment and identify potential problems before they lead to failures. The goal is to make sure that trains can be operated safely, even in the face of human error and external factors.
